    FORD LOTUS CORTINA - Alan Mann Racing FORD LOTUS CORTINA The history of the Cortina Lotus began in 1961. Colin Chapman had been wishing to build his own engines for Lotus, mainly because the Coventry Climax unit was so expensive. Colin Chapman's chance came when he commissioned Harry Mundy to design a twin-cam version of the Ford Kent engine.

    Alan Mann wrote in his book that the cars probably couldn’t have completed another couple of laps, such was the state of the back axles in both cars! In July 1964 AMR were invited to enter the 24hr Spa Francorchamps race, along with 2 standard Lotus Cortinas entered by Ford of Belgium. AMR built two new cars for this race, EHK 489B and EHK 490B.
